Output d151560d4ef57e3b0e5f8d381e564dc143f1bed94af6733c9bde451eae6e37e8: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d85f865dfd01f397edec0a1495697291bcaf372 OP_EQUAL
address
3ADXFoafB8mK1dp4rqJ4MbEHBKhVUDrCug
transaction
d151560d4ef57e3b0e5f8d381e564dc143f1bed94af6733c9bde451eae6e37e8
confirmations
176269
spent
true